Insurance for artists is a specialized type of coverage that is designed to protect against the unique risks faced by creative professionals From damage to your studio or equipment to liability issues that may arise during exhibitions or art shows, having the right insurance in place can provide peace of mind and financial security Here are some of the best insurance options for artists to consider:

1 Artwork Insurance:
One of the most important types of insurance for artists is artwork insurance This coverage can protect your pieces against damage, theft, or loss while they are on display in galleries, studios, or during transit Artwork insurance can also cover the cost of restoration or repairs if your pieces are damaged in any way Make sure to get appraisals of your work and keep detailed records of each piece to ensure you have the proper coverage in place.

2 General Liability Insurance:
General liability insurance is essential for artists who display their work in public spaces or sell their pieces at art shows and events This coverage can protect you in case someone is injured on your property or if your artwork causes damage to someone else’s property Even if you work from home or in a studio, having general liability insurance can provide crucial protection against unexpected accidents or incidents.

For artists who work from a studio space, studio insurance can provide coverage for your tools, equipment, and supplies This type of insurance can protect against theft, fire, vandalism, and other perils that may damage or destroy your workspace Studio insurance can also cover business interruption expenses if your studio is temporarily unusable due to a covered loss.

4 Fine Art Insurance:
Fine art insurance is a specialized type of coverage that is designed for high-value artwork, collectibles, and antiques If you create pieces that are considered valuable or rare, such as limited edition prints or original paintings, fine art insurance can provide coverage for these more precious items This type of insurance can also cover artwork that is in transit or on loan to galleries or exhibitions.

5 Business Interruption Insurance:
Business interruption insurance can provide financial protection if your art business is temporarily shut down due to a covered loss, such as a fire or natural disaster This coverage can help you pay your bills and expenses while your business is closed and can help you get back on your feet after a disaster occurs.

In addition to these specific types of insurance, artists may also benefit from other forms of coverage, such as equipment insurance, cyber liability insurance, or workers’ compensation insurance if you have employees Working with an insurance agent who specializes in working with artists can help you customize a policy that meets your unique needs and budget.

When shopping for insurance as an artist, make sure to compare quotes from multiple providers, review the coverage options and exclusions carefully, and ask about any discounts or additional coverage options that may be available It’s also important to regularly review and update your insurance coverage as your art business grows and evolves.
